Job description

Clemson Eye is a growing, multi-specialty ophthalmology practice. We are looking for individuals to handle patient communication for surgery. The successful candidate must have an optimistic outlook and excellent interpersonal skills. Some travel to local sites will be required. Overtime may be required.

Job Responsibilities
  • Demonstrate comprehensive knowledge of all aspects of eye surgery to effectively address patient inquiries.
  • Efficiently schedule surgeries, coordinating with patients and providing clear instructions for pre‑ and post‑operative care.
  • Prepare detailed charts for all scheduled surgeries, ensuring accuracy and completeness.
  • Have a basic understanding of how insurance works for common insurance plans in the area, such as Medicare payers, Medicare Advantage Plans, and Commercial Plans.
  • Educate patients on insurance, including deductibles and out‑of‑pocket costs.
  • Engage in telephone correspondence with surgical patients as needed, addressing inquiries and providing necessary information.
  • Organize patient charts systematically and update all pertinent information for surgical procedures.
